000019787 520__ $$2eng$$aThis paper presents an overview of the basis and methodologies proposed for seismic design of High Consequence Dikes in Southwestern British Columbia, Canada and challenges faced during implementing the Guidelines for two local dikes constructed over a thick deposit of liquefiable sands. The Guidelines adopt a combination of traditional and performancebased design criteria for the seismic design of dikes. Dike seismic performance is specified in terms of measureable indicators such as crest displacement and settlement of the dike structure. The methodologies and criteria were established following a review of practices currently followed in other regions of the world that are also prone to high seismic hazards.
